Step 1: Initial Assessment

Our technicians arrive at your property to conduct a thorough assessment of the damage, identifying the extent of the water damage and any potential safety hazards. They'll use specialized equipment to detect hidden water damage and find out the best course of action for restoration.

Step 2: Water Removal

We'll extract the standing water from your property using powerful pumps and vacuums, ensuring the area is completely dry and free of any remaining moisture. Our team will also remove any affected materials, such as drywall, carpet, or insulation.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We'll use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to speed up the drying process, ensuring your property is completely dry and free of any remaining moisture.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Once the drying process is complete, our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ize your property, removing any remaining debris, dirt, or bacteria. We'll also use specialized equipment to remove any lingering odors and leave your property smelling fresh and clean.

Step 5: Restoration and Repair

Our final step is to restore your property to its original condition, repairing any damaged materials and replacing any necessary parts. We'll work closely with you to ensure the final result meets your expectations and exceeds your satisfaction.

Warning Signs You Need Downspout Failure Water Removal

Catching these warning signs early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ent further damage to your property. Don't ignore these red flags - act fast and call a pro when you notice any of the following signs:

Musty Odors That Won't Go Away

Unpleasant odors can be a sign of hidden water damage or mold growth. If you notice persistent musty smells in your home, it's essential to investigate further and address the issue quickly.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ls

Water stains can be a sign of a more significant issue, such as a leaky downspout or roof damage. Don't ignore these stains - they can lead to costly repairs and structural damage if left unaddressed.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or high humidity.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it's crucial to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age or high humidity. If you notice any changes in your walls or ceilings, it's essential to investigate further and address the issue quickly.

Water Damage to Your Attic or Crawl Space

Water damage in your attic or crawl space can be a sign of a more significant issue, such as a leaky roof or foundation damage. Don't ignore these areas - they can lead to costly repairs and structural damage if left unaddressed.

Visible Water Leaks or Puddles

Visible water leaks or puddles can be a sign of a more significant issue, such as a leaky downspout or roof damage. Don't ignore these signs - they can lead to costly repairs and structural damage if left unaddressed.

Downspout Failure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ak from a downspout Yes No You can likely fix the issue yourself with some basic plumbing knowledge and tools.
Large water leak from a downspout No Yes A large leak can cause extensive damage and need specialized equipment to fix.
Water damage to your attic or crawl space No Yes These areas can be difficult to access and need specialized equipment to fix.
Musty odors or visible mold growth No Yes Mold growth can be hazardous to your health and need specialized equipment to remove.
Water damage to your walls or ceilings No Yes Water damage to these areas can be extensive and need specialized equipment to fix.
Visible water leaks or puddles No Yes Visible water leaks or puddles can be a sign of a more significant issue and need immediate attention.

Downspout Failure Water Removal Cost in Alta Mesa, AZ

The cost of Downspout Failure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Alta Mesa, AZ.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on your specific situation. It's essential to note that the longer you wait to address the issue, the more expensive the repairs will become.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ment $100 - $500 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Water Removal $500 - $2,500 Amount of water extracted and equipment used
Drying and Dehumidification $200 - $1,000 Size of affected area and equipment used
Cleaning and Sanitizing $100 - $500 Size of affected area and equipment used
Restoration and Repair $1,000 - $5,000 Severity of damage and materials needed
Final Inspection and Certificate of Completion $100 - $500 Size of affected area and complexity of repairs

Common Questions About Downspout Failure Water Removal

Q: What causes downspout failure?

A: Downspout failure can be caused by a variety of factors, including clogged gutters, improper downspout installation, and weather-related events such as heavy rainfall or hail. Our team can help identify the root cause of the issue and provide recommendations for prevention.

Q: Can I prevent downspout failure?

A: Yes, there are steps you can take to prevent downspout failure, including regular gutter cleaning, proper downspout installation, and maintenance. Our team can provide recommendations for prevention and help you identify potential issues before they become major problems.
